WEST DES MOINES, Iowa — A local shelter is empty after they found foster homes for their animals to spend the holiday weekend in.
Furry Friends spent the week finding foster homes for their animals in an effort to keep them comfortable over the weekend.
The shelter is located across the street from where West Des Moines sets off its fireworks display. Staff says it’s too close for comfort and puts unnecessary stress on the animals.
“Unfortunately, this event is terrible for the animals. Fireworks are always difficult, and there are fireworks in the neighborhood. This display shakes the entire building, said Britt Gagne, with Furry Friends Animal Shelter. “We watch them light the fireworks from our front window, see the people lighting them up. It’s just way too close for these animals who have already been through a lot of trauma.”
The shelter had enough applicants to empty their shelter and give all their animals a stay-cation that will last through the weekend.
